From: Zbigniew Jędrzejewski-Szmek Date: Thu, 21 Sep 2023 10:56:37 +0000 (+0200) Subject: netdev/wireguard: define iterator variable in the loop X-Git-Tag: v255-rc1~458^2 X-Git-Url: http://git.ipfire.org/gitweb.cgi?a=commitdiff_plain;h=f75921c7fd36be2139cae921bd6510c8a33182c1;p=thirdparty%2Fsystemd.git netdev/wireguard: define iterator variable in the loop --- diff --git a/src/network/netdev/wireguard.c b/src/network/netdev/wireguard.c index 14f664e9830..c89577609d4 100644 --- a/src/network/netdev/wireguard.c +++ b/src/network/netdev/wireguard.c @@ -225,13 +225,12 @@ cancel: static int wireguard_set_interface(NetDev *netdev) { _cleanup_(sd_netlink_message_unrefp) sd_netlink_message *message = NULL; WireguardIPmask *mask_start = NULL; - WireguardPeer *peer_start; bool sent_once = false; uint32_t serial; Wireguard *w = WIREGUARD(netdev); int r; - for (peer_start = w->peers; peer_start || !sent_once; ) { + for (WireguardPeer *peer_start = w->peers; peer_start || !sent_once; ) { uint16_t i = 0; message = sd_netlink_message_unref(message);